What is Inconel 600?

Inconel 600 is a nickel-chromium alloy known for its exceptional resistance to high temperatures and corrosion. It’s composed of nickel, chromium, and iron, with small amounts of other elements like copper and manganese. This unique combination of metals gives Inconel 600 its remarkable properties, making it suitable for a wide range of applications.

High Temperature Resistance

One of the standout features of Inconel 600 tubing is its ability to withstand extreme temperatures. Whether it’s soaring heat in industrial furnaces or cryogenic conditions in aerospace applications, this alloy remains stable and reliable. Its high melting point makes it ideal for environments where other materials would simply melt or degrade.

Corrosion Resistance

In addition to its heat resistance, Inconel 600 offers impressive corrosion resistance. It can withstand attack from a variety of corrosive substances, including acids, alkalis, and salts. This makes it indispensable in industries where exposure to harsh chemicals is common, such as chemical processing plants and offshore oil rigs.

Versatility in Applications

The versatility of Inconel 600 tubing extends across a wide range of industries. From aerospace components to heat exchangers in power plants, its properties make it suitable for diverse applications:

  • Aerospace: Inconel 600 tubing is used in aircraft engines, exhaust systems, and other high-temperature components.
  • Chemical Processing: Its resistance to corrosive substances makes it ideal for equipment in chemical processing plants.
  • Marine Engineering: Inconel 600 is commonly used in marine applications where exposure to saltwater and harsh environments is a concern.
  • Nuclear Power: Its combination of heat resistance and corrosion resistance makes it valuable in nuclear reactors and related infrastructure.
